Muon Tracker brings the fascinating phenomenon of muon detection right to your device. Designed for science enthusiasts, students, and educators, this app simulates the detection of high-energy muons—particles created when cosmic rays collide with the upper atmosphere—and visualizes them in real time.
What it does
• Simulates the arrival of cosmic muons based on your current location (latitude, longitude, and altitude).
• Accurately models muon flux and angular distribution, including diurnal and seasonal variations.
• Detects and visualizes muon tracks with animated directional paths, energy estimates, and impact points on your screen.
• Displays real-time rates and calculated flux in particles per second and per square meter.
• Offers a data panel where you can explore and export historical events with timestamps, angles, and energy in GeV.
Scientific accuracy - Muon Tracker is powered by a physics-based simulation engine that factors in:
• Atmospheric depth modeling to vary muon rates with elevation
• Geomagnetic latitude effects to reflect regional muon flux
• Angular dependency using a cosine-squared distribution to simulate slant tracks
• Randomized yet statistically valid energy distributions typical of atmospheric muons
The simulation mimics real-world detection environments scaled to your device’s screen size. Whether you’re at sea level or on a mountain, the simulated flux adjusts accordingly.
